1887 (16 Mar) cover with blue "Shanghai Local Post" departure postmark on back, franked on front with 3 Can red, cancelled (not tied) by oval chop, perf. faults, sent via the French Post Office in Shanghai, with 25c Type Sage added for further transmission to Gross Salze, with arrival postmark (24 Apr), wax seal removed from back, filing folds away from the stamps, some overall wear and toning, otherwise a fine and rare item, signed Roger Calves, but since the Large Dragon is not tied, the cover is offered AS IS -
